**Rat-Alarm** is a Portland, Oregon-based noise rock/punk duo known for their raw, chaotic energy and DIY ethos. Formed in 2018 by guitarist/vocalist Max Wolf and drummer Tessa Nguyen, the pair quickly carved out a niche in the underground scene with their blistering live shows and lo-fi recordings. Their sound blends distorted guitars, frenetic rhythms, and shouted vocals, channeling the spirit of ‘80s hardcore while injecting a sardonic, modern edge. Recent releases like *Retrieve and Return I* and *II* (2023) and their self-titled *Rat-Alarm* (2022) showcase their knack for short, explosive tracks that feel like a sonic middle finger to complacency.
Though they keep their backstory cryptic, Rat-Alarm’s lyrics often tackle themes of urban decay, existential dread, and capitalist absurdity, resonating with fans who crave music with teeth. They’ve built a cult following through relentless touring of dive bars, house shows, and DIY spaces, where their no-frills intensity turns every gig into a cathartic riot.
